    Zog reminds me of recess. After long days at work, finally I get to go outside and play! A friend told me about ZogSports. I was hesitant because I've never played any organized sports, am not in great shape, and know only general football rules. I signed up for Touch Football as "extremely casual." Perfect fit! I found that other players were inclusive and there to have fun. The referees and staff (thanks Caitlin & Matt) are patient and helpful. I tried a different LA social sports league one season and was disappointed that it wasn't as friendly or organized. Zog is an important part of my week now. I look forward to happy hour, joking with friends, and burning off the tension of busy days. I currently play on 3 Zog football teams. It's a stress release. I joke that, "Zog is my therapy."

    If you want to play for fun and you are not overly competitive this is the league for you. As for myself I have played competitive softball pretty much all my life not to mention i have played in college too so I find the level of competiveness a little on the weak side. I have met some cool people and they do give some money to charity so that's a good thing. Not sure how much goes to them but at least they donate. I think that's their motto, playing for a cause since their league fees are super expensive. There a few things I dislike about the league. One is that they claim that we have a sponsor but never get anything from the sponsor. So how is that sponsorship? Not sure about that one. I would usually not say anything about it but they put the sponsor on the shirts that WE pay for. Shouldn't we decide if we want the sponsor logo on our shirts or not? What happens if we don't like the sponsor ? haha anyway... Second thing I dislike is that some of the umpires are new never had experience umping a game. They train them which is fine but are not completely aware of the rules. This causes a lot of conflicts between teams of who is right an who is wrong. Lastly, this is a 'for profit' organization so the fees are pretty high compared to other leagues. This league only has seven games plus playoffs. If you don't mind paying that then give it a GO. Hope this helps...
